Metadata-Version: 2.2
Name: init-film
Version: 1.2.3
Summary: Tired of manually creating folder structures for your film/video projects? Want a folder structure that dynamically changes based on the needs for your project? Then Init-Film was made for you! By filmmakers, for filmmakers ;)
Author: Andreas Delabie
Author-email: andreas.delabie@gmail.com
License: MIT
Project-URL: Repository, https://github.com/andreasdelabie/init-film
Project-URL: Changelog, https://github.com/andreasdelabie/init-film/releases
Project-URL: Issues, https://github.com/andreasdelabie/init-film/issues
Project-URL: Donate, https://www.buymeacoffee.com/andreasdelabie
Classifier: Development Status :: 5 - Production/Stable
Classifier: Programming Language :: Python :: 3
Classifier: Operating System :: OS Independent
Classifier: Natural Language :: English
Classifier: Environment :: Console
Classifier: Intended Audience :: End Users/Desktop
Classifier: License :: OSI Approved :: MIT License
Classifier: Topic :: Multimedia :: Video
Requires-Python: >=3.8
Description-Content-Type: text/markdown
License-File: LICENSE
Requires-Dist: importlib.metadata>8.6

# Init-Film  
![image](https://github.com/user-attachments/assets/9d9dd462-6b83-4ac7-a3d9-4efb88e4fb72)  
Tired of manually creating folder structures for your film/video projects?  
Want a folder structure that dynamically changes based on the needs for your project?  
Then Init-Film was made for you!  
By filmmakers, for filmmakers ;)  
### ->>[Watch showcase](https://www.youtube.com/watch?v=QheWe-1PqUM)<<-  


## Before installing:  
Make sure you have any of the following [Python](https://www.python.org/) versions installed (tested with tox):  
  - [3.13](https://www.python.org/downloads/release/python-3131/) (recommended)  
  - [3.12](https://www.python.org/downloads/release/python-3128/)  
  - [3.11](https://www.python.org/downloads/release/python-3119/)  
  - [3.10](https://www.python.org/downloads/release/python-31011/)  
  - [3.9](https://www.python.org/downloads/release/python-3913/)  
  - [3.8](https://www.python.org/downloads/release/python-3810/)  


## Installation:  
### Method 1 (from PyPi):  
[Watch YouTube tutorial](https://www.youtube.com/watch?v=Z5_rhFlNFM8)  
Use `pip install init-film` to install the latest version of init-film.  

### Method 2 (from source):  
[Watch YouTube tutorial](https://www.youtube.com/watch?v=oiKy_RU5WHE)  
1. Download the repo by using `git clone https://github.com/andreasdelabie/init-film` or download the zip folder from the [releases](https://github.com/andreasdelabie/init-film/releases).  
2. Navigate to the folder by using `cd [path to folder]` or using a file explorer.  
3. Use `pip install .` to install the script.

### Error: externally-managed-environment
![image](https://github.com/user-attachments/assets/71cae57b-8baf-4a1f-b0ac-3bbf978bff38)  
Check out the documentation for [externally managed environments](https://github.com/andreasdelabie/init-film/blob/main/README-ExternallyManagedEnvironments.md).


## Usage:  
[Watch showcase](https://www.youtube.com/watch?v=QheWe-1PqUM)  
### Basic usage:  
Use the CLI command `init-film` in any folder to start a new film/video project.  
### Custom folder names:  
Folder names can't contain spaces (with the exception of the project name). Instead use a `-` or `_`.  
### Add shortcut to Windows context menu (right click menu):  
Use `init-film --add-shortcut` to add Init-Film to your Windows context menu.  
Use `init-film --remove-shortcut` to remove it.  
### Help:  
Use `init-film --help` or `init-film -h` to show the help screen.  


## Updating:  
Use `pip install --upgrade init-film` to update to the latest version of init-film.  


## Uninstalling:  
Use `pip uninstall init-film` to fully uninstall init-film from your system.


## Support:  
<a href="https://www.buymeacoffee.com/andreasdelabie"><img src="https://img.buymeacoffee.com/button-api/?text=Buy me a coffee&emoji=☕&slug=andreasdelabie&button_colour=FFDD00&font_colour=000000&font_family=Comic&outline_colour=000000&coffee_colour=ffffff"/></a>  
